The Opium Coffee Table is a striking example of Axel Vervoordt’s timeless design philosophy, where simplicity, craftsmanship, and materiality come together in perfect balance. Designed in Belgium, this sculptural low coffee table embodies the understated elegance for which Vervoordt has become internationally renowned. The table features an impressive top crafted from thick bamboo veneer, showcasing a rich and expressive grain pattern arranged in a subtle geometric composition. The warm, deep tones of the bamboo create a beautiful contrast with the robust architectural base, emphasizing the natural character and texture of the material. Supporting the top is a solid wooden base, constructed using traditional wedged mortise-and-tenon joinery. This honest construction method highlights the artisanal quality of the piece while providing exceptional stability and durability. The low, monolithic silhouette gives the table a strong presence, making it equally suitable for minimalist, wabi-sabi, postmodern, and contemporary interiors. Belgian designer Axel Vervoordt is internationally renowned for his timeless interiors, art collections, and refined minimalist aesthetic. His work is deeply rooted in natural materials, balance, and the beauty of imperfection, often associated with the principles of wabi-sabi.
